The Impact of Temperature on Paint Application



When you're preparing a commercial outside painting job, the temperature can significantly impact just how well the paint sticks and dries out.

On the other side, if it's too warm, the paint can dry too swiftly, stopping correct attachment and leading to an unequal finish.

You ought to also consider the moment of day; early morning or late afternoon uses cooler temperature levels, which can be a lot more beneficial.

Always check the manufacturer's referrals for the details paint you're making use of, as they commonly give advice on the perfect temperature range for optimum results.

Moisture and Its Impact on Drying Times



Temperature level isn't the only ecological variable that influences your commercial external paint task; moisture plays a significant role as well. High moisture levels can decrease drying out times significantly, affecting the total top quality of your paint job.



When the air is filled with moisture, the paint takes longer to cure, which can bring about problems like inadequate adhesion and a greater threat of mildew development. If you're repainting on a specifically moist day, be prepared for extensive delay times in between coats.

It's essential to keep an eye on local weather conditions and plan accordingly. Ideally, go for moisture degrees between 40% and 70% for optimum drying.

Keeping these consider mind ensures your project remains on track and supplies an enduring finish.

Best Seasons for Commercial Exterior Painting Projects



What's the best time of year for your business outside paint projects?

Springtime and early loss are normally your best bets. Throughout these seasons, temperature levels are moderate, and humidity levels are often reduced, creating optimal conditions for paint application and drying.

Avoid summer's intense heat, which can trigger paint to dry also swiftly, bring about bad bond and coating. Similarly, winter season's cool temperature levels can prevent proper drying and curing, taking the chance of the long life of your paint task.

Go for days with temperatures in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for ideal results. Remember to examine the regional weather report for rainfall, as damp conditions can wreck your project.

Planning around these variables ensures your paint project runs smoothly and lasts longer.
